Sharing Your Versions: A Comprehensive Look at Cover Song Distribution

Diving into the world of cover song distribution can feel overwhelming. A plethora of aspiring artists are vying for attention, and standing out from the crowd requires a strategic approach. To begin, understanding your target audience is crucial. Are you aiming for fans of the original artist? A specific genre niche? This will help you tailor your distribution strategy accordingly.

Remember, dedication is key. Regularly releasing new covers and engaging with your fans will help you build momentum and establish yourself in the cover song landscape.
